Claims
- 1. A variable volume system for controlling the position of a damper to regulate a condition of air in a duct, said system comprising:
- air velocity sensor means comprising first nozzle means and second nozzle means for directly measuring the velocity of air moving past said first and second nozzle means, said first and second nozzle means adapted to be arranged for sensing said condition of said air in said duct by passing at least a portion of said air past said first and second nozzle means, said first nozzle means arranged to issue a jet of fluid and said second nozzle means arranged for receiving a portion of said fluid dependent upon said condition of said air;
- fluid supply terminal means;
- first connecting means connecting said terminal means to said first nozzle means.Iadd., said first connecting means including condition responsive pressure control means for regulating the fluid supplied to said first nozzle means to control the velocity of said jet of fluid.Iaddend.;
- damper actuator means adapted to control the position of said damper; and,
- second connecting means connecting said second nozzle means to said damper actuator means for varying the position of said damper dependent upon said condition of said air and dependent upon the velocity of said jet of fluid.
- 2. The system according to claim 1 wherein said second connecting means comprises an amplifier having a control chamber connected to said second nozzle means, a diaphragm, and a nozzle, controlled by said diaphragm, connected by means to said fluid supply terminal means.
- 3. The systemm according to claim 1 wherein said fluid supply terminal means comprises inlet port means located in the duct such that said system is self contained.
- 4. The system according to claim 3 wherein said second connecting means comprises an amplifier having a control chamber connected to said second nozzle means, a diaphragm and a nozzle, controlled by said diaphragm, connected by means to said inlet port means.
- 5. The system according to claim 4 wherein said damper actuator means comprises a bellows connected to said means connecting said nozzle of said amplifier to said inlet port means.
- 6. The system according to claim 1 wherein said first and second nozzle means are located non-axially to said air moving past said first and second nozzle means.
